How much do salesforce administrator j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for salesforce administrator in Racine, WI is $92,701.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$70,800.00 and $111,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Salesforce Administrator?

A Salesforce Administrator is a professional responsible for managing and configuring a Salesforce platform within an organization. They handle tasks such as user management, data maintenance, creating reports and dashboards, and customizing the system to meet business needs. Salesforce Administrators serve as the primary point of contact for users and ensure the platform is used efficiently and effectively. They also stay updated on new Salesforce features and implement best practices to support business operations.

What does a Salesforce Administrator do?

A Salesforce administrator’s duties are to coordinate and oversee various aspects of a company’s workflow, business operations, and productivity using Salesforce software. They work with end users, helping them resolve technical issues and developing new ways to manage and store data in a cloud environment. If a Salesforce administrator works more closely with end users, their responsibilities often involve utilizing the Salesforce customer relationship management (CRM) tools to facilitate business relationships. Qualifications to become a Salesforce administrator include a bachelor’s degree and professional certification in the Salesforce platform or specific resources, such as the CRM tools.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Salesforce Administ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Salesforce Administrator, you need a solid understanding of CRM principles, data management, and Salesforce platform functionality, usually supported by a bachelor's degree and Salesforce Administrator certification. Familiarity with tools like Salesforce Lightning, workflows, process builder, and third-party integration apps is typically expected. Strong problem-solving, communication, and organizational skills help you manage user needs and translate business requirements into effective system solutions. These competencies ensure efficient platform management, support business operations, and drive user adoption of Salesforce solutions.

What are some common challenges Salesforce Administrators face when managing user requests and system updates?

Salesforce Administrators often juggle multiple user requests while ensuring the platform remains efficient and secure. A common challenge is prioritizing urgent support tickets alongside larger projects, such as system updates or new feature rollouts. Admins must also balance customization requests with best practices to avoid unnecessary complexity. Effective communication with stakeholders and ongoing user training are key to overcoming these challenges and maintaining a smooth-running Salesforce environment.

What is the difference between Salesforce Administrator vs Salesforce Business Analyst?

AspectSalesforce AdministratorSalesforce Business Analyst
CertificationsSalesforce Certified AdministratorSalesforce Certified Administrator (plus analysis skills)
Primary RoleManage and configure Salesforce platform, user management, data upkeepGather requirements, analyze business processes, recommend Salesforce solutions
Work EnvironmentAdministering Salesforce in daily operations, technical setupCollaborating with stakeholders, translating business needs into Salesforce features
Industry UsageCommon in organizations using Salesforce for CRMOften works alongside Salesforce Admins in CRM projects

While both roles involve Salesforce, the Salesforce Administrator focuses on platform management and configuration, whereas the Salesforce Business Analyst emphasizes understanding business needs and translating them into Salesforce solutions. Both roles often collaborate but serve different functions within Salesforce projects.
